Hi Vince:
You will need the appropriate sample prep equipment (this will depend on the type and size of sample).
For the actual assaying, you will need balances (both sample and microbalance).
You will need probably two furnaces: fusion and cupellation.
These can be either gas or electric. Pay close attention to venting of both furnaces to remove lead fumes. Also, pay close attention to air/oxygen in the cupellation furnace. Proper airflow is needed to provide oxygen to the molten lead for oxidation to PbO.
There are quite a few specialty tools and safety equipment you will need (tongs, gloves, hoods, etc).
If you can provide a bit more information on the type of samples, and number of samples per day I can provide more specific recommendations.
